Why repairability now defines sustainable computing

Laptop emissions come from metals, screens, and chips. Thin sealed designs shorten lifespan. Repairable machines reverse this trend.

Three ideas dominate.

Energy efficiency per watt.
Apple silicon leads due to high performance with low power. Fanless designs reduce failure points.

Repair and upgrade access.
Replaceable RAM and storage extend useful life. ThinkPad and Acer Aspire models perform well. Soldered parts score lower.

Material circularity.
Recycled aluminium and ocean bound plastics reduce extraction. Dell and HP integrate closed loop plastics at scale.

Metrics used in ranking
Performance per watt.
Repair and upgrade access.
Recycled material share.
Manufacturing emissions reduction processes.
Expected resale value.
